League Updates and Events:
GLORY Kickboxing is actively expanding its presence, recently announcing a partnership with Jake Paul`s company Betr.
The promotion is also preparing for significant events, such as a massive 32-man heavyweight tournament designed to be a major spectacle.
Coverage extends to past events like GLORY 90, providing access to results and discussions.
Similarly, ONE Championship featured notable bouts, including Rodtang`s swift victory over Takeru and the clash between Superlek and Takeru, with live streams provided for preliminary fights like ONE Friday Fights 46.
Fighter Stories and Legends:
The collection delves into compelling fighter narratives. From GLORY, stories include a $1M tournament competitor who demonstrated remarkable resilience by overcoming a serious injury.
Another highlight is a peculiar first-round knockout delivered by a towering 6`9″ fighter.
There are also inspiring accounts of fighters who successfully balance their careers in combat sports with other civilian professions.
Looking back, the material revisits legendary moments, such as Bob Sapp`s surprising upsets against a kickboxing prodigy, considered one of the sport`s strangest stories.
The journey of Ramon Dekkers, from a “skinny Dutch kid” to a revered Muay Thai icon who challenged legends in Thailand, is also recounted.
Alex Pereira`s impressive career before the UFC is showcased, including a spectacular highlight-reel flying knockout that won him a title.
Discussions about current champions, like ONE Bantamweight titleholder Jonathan Haggerty, mention the pressure that comes with being a prime target for contenders. Jean-Claude Van Damme`s influence on Rico Verhoeven, leading him to discover a passion outside the ring, adds a personal touch.
Community and Future Development:
Beyond the competition, the kickboxing community faces challenges. A somber note is struck with an appeal for support for the family of an amateur competitor who suffered a severe, irreversible brain injury during a tournament.
Discussions about the sport`s future are also present, notably the proposal by Joe Rogan and Israel Adesanya for the UFC to establish its own kickboxing league, aiming to attract top strikers globally and potentially compete with promotions like ONE Championship.
